Structural foundation repair services focus on addressing iss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ically involve assessing the foundation’s condition, identifying areas of damage or movement, and implementing appropriate repair techniques. Common methods include underpinning, piering, and slab stabilization, which help restore the foundation’s strength and prevent further deterioration. The goal is to ensure the structure remains safe, level, and capable of supporting the weight of the entire building.
Problems that lead to the need for foundation repair often include settling, cracking, or shifting of the foundation material. These issues can result from soil movement, moisture changes, poor construction practices, or natural settling over time. Signs of foundation problems may include uneven floors, visible cracks in walls or ceilings,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around doorframes. Addressing these issues promptly can help prevent more extensive damage to the property’s structure and interior finishes.

Foundation Repair Cost - Typical expenses for structural foundation repair services range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age. For example, minor cracks may cost around $2,000, while major underpinning could exceed $7,000. Costs vary based on the project's complexity and location.
Foundation Repair Factors - The overall cost is influenced by factors such as soil conditions, foundation type, and the repair method chosen. Repairs in Gambrills, MD, might fall within a similar range but can fluctuate based on local soil and foundation specifics. Contact local pros for tailored estimates.
Common Repair Methods - Methods like pier and beam support or slab jacking typically cost between $1,500 and $6,500. The specific approach affects the price, with more invasive procedures generally being more costly. Prices vary according to the severity of foundation issues.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include excavation, soil stabilization, or waterproofing, which can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ars. These expenses depend on site conditions and the scope of repairs needed.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on individual cases.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window frames or door jambs.
How long does a typical foundation repair take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but most projects can range from a few days to several weeks.
Are there different types of foundation repair methods? Yes, options include underpinning, piering, slabjacking, and wall reinforcement, selected based on the specific foundation problem and soil conditions.
